摘要
A relevant issue associated with the environmental impact of current and future technologies is the balance between performance and sustainability. In this regard, there is an effort to increase the sustainability of energy storage systems and, in particular, of lithium-ion batteries, by replacing the most harmful battery components with environmentally friendlier ones. The application of ionic liquids, both as a replacement for electrolytes or solid polymer electrolytes, is a promising strategy to achieve this goal. In this work, a perspective of the use of ionic liquids for lithium-ion batteries is presented, focusing on the main used types, and their applications in separators and solid polymer electrolytes. The future trends in the use of ionic liquids for battery systems are also presented. Considering their properties and features widely reported in the literature, the use of ionic liquids for energy storage systems has the potential to properly address sustainability issues without jeopardizing their performance. We present a review on the current state-of-the-art of ionic liquids for the development of electrolytes, both conventional and solid-state. This review article provides a thorough summary of the developments achieved in this field.
